Earthquake in Myanmar also felt in Chiang Rai
An earthquake measuring 5.2 on the Richter scale and centred in Myanmar was felt in many districts of Thailand's northernmost province of Chiang Rai on Monday.
Natthawut Dandee, deputy director-general of the meterology department, said the quake was detected at 3.06pm with the epicentre 10 kilometres underground in Myanmar, 132 kilometres northeast of Chiang Rai's Mae Sai district.
The department's Earthquake Observation Division reported the quake was felt in office buildings, houses and apartment buildings in Mae Chan, Mae Lao, Mae Sai, Muang and Wiang Chai districts of Chiang Rai.
